so stay with me...HOW TO LOAD REGISTRATIONS INTO THE TYROS
(1) Now that you have Winzip installed, unzip the Registrations. Ooops, I forgot to explain how.All right, find the Registrations download on your computer screen (it may be a web link, or an email attachment), and click on it. You should get a gray popup that asks if you want to SAVE the file or to
OPEN it.  Click on "OPEN."(2) Now you will get a big Winzip File that asks you to make another choice. Either "Buy Now," or "Use Evaluation Version."  Unless you love spending money, click on the Evaluation Version (you can "evaluate"
for years.)
(3) Now comes the FUN part. You will instantly see all your files UNZIPPED, in their naked glory (pant, drool)... and you can load ANY or ALL of them to a disk.
To do this, simply put your cursor in the lower right area, hold down the LEFT mouse button, and then
swoop it to the left and then upward.... this will highlight them, and now you just RIGHT CLICK on the
highlighted area, and look for the word "extract" -- put your cursor on it and now LEFT CLICK to extract them. TO WHAT?Well, when you "left click" on "EXTRACT," you should get a popup showing you several choices -- and you should highlight "3 1/2 Floppy (A)" and then click at the lower right on EXTRACT... which should load all your now-unzipped Registrations (and more) onto a fresh, clean, IBM-formatted floppy disk. (Which, bless you,
you have previously inserted into your computer's floppy drive.)See how simple it all is? (Yeah, right, Dave.)(4) Remove disk from computer and insert into Tyros, then press the REG. BANK button (located next to FREEZE button).(5) Now look for the BACK/NEXT buttons at upper right of display screen. If you're not in the FD area, go there now by pressing either BACK or NEXT until you get there.(6) At this point, you should see the Registrations displayed on screen.(7) To access a specific Registration Bank, press a button on either side of the Display Screen (A to J) -- which should highlight the bank.(8) Now simply press any of the (1-8) Registration buttons to bring up the exact Registration you want.
(9) Next, be sure the ACMP (Accompaniment) button at far left side, is turned ON.(10) Finally, press any of the 3 "Intro" buttons so that it lights, and then press SYNCH / START so that it also lights.(11) NOW YOU ARE READY to make music with the Registrations. To get the Accompaniment started, just press any black or white key on the left side.
(12) After the Intro, play your melody.   Remember, use the left hand keys to to make any chord changes needed.(And speaking of chords, it's best to use the Tyros chord setting called "MULTI-FINGER," because with it you can make chords with ONE FINGER or with SEVERAL.)
(13) Since I used the same "Style" for nearly ALL of the Registrations, you will probably at some point want a different style. To get a style you'd prefer, first press the FREEZE button so that it lights, THEN press a style type button (let's say "Ballad") -- then select (and highlight) one of these by pressing a display button (A thru J).(14) Once you have selected a Style you like, press the Registration Bank button to again return to your Registration choices.(15) From here, you can select any Registration you like. Remember, these were "converted" from the 9000, so some will not be lighted and will not work -- and others may be lighted and still not work properly.   So please don't be like those who bitch and moan that "some don't sound good."   It's YOUR job to find the ones that DO sound good to you, and use them.Well, that's it. You can now play using any Registration Bank you select. THERE'S JUST ONE MORE THING you should do, however, to make your life complete... and that is to...
